How they compare

Saint Lucia currently reports 1.75 billion international-$ in 2011 prices against 1.68 billion international-$ in 2011 prices in Comoros, a difference of 67.01 million international-$ in 2011 prices.

The two have swapped places 12 times across 73 shared years of data; in 1950 it was Saint Lucia ahead.

Comoros ranks 163rd and Saint Lucia ranks 162nd of 165 countries.

Across the 8 decades both report, Comoros averaged higher in 1 and Saint Lucia in 7.

Head to head by decade

Decade Comoros Saint Lucia Difference Ahead
1950s 95.93 million international-$ in 2011 prices 118.31 million international-$ in 2011 prices 22.38 million international-$ in 2011 prices Saint Lucia
1960s 173.37 million international-$ in 2011 prices 180.67 million international-$ in 2011 prices 7.31 million international-$ in 2011 prices Saint Lucia
1970s 275.31 million international-$ in 2011 prices 293.77 million international-$ in 2011 prices 18.46 million international-$ in 2011 prices Saint Lucia
1980s 429.39 million international-$ in 2011 prices 491.47 million international-$ in 2011 prices 62.08 million international-$ in 2011 prices Saint Lucia
1990s 554.94 million international-$ in 2011 prices 884.29 million international-$ in 2011 prices 329.35 million international-$ in 2011 prices Saint Lucia
2000s 807.64 million international-$ in 2011 prices 1.32 billion international-$ in 2011 prices 515.88 million international-$ in 2011 prices Saint Lucia
2010s 1.28 billion international-$ in 2011 prices 1.70 billion international-$ in 2011 prices 421.81 million international-$ in 2011 prices Saint Lucia
2020s 1.64 billion international-$ in 2011 prices 1.54 billion international-$ in 2011 prices 96.48 million international-$ in 2011 prices Comoros

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
